The Wiser - 15Mins Book Summaries app is designed to provide users with concise, high-quality summaries of popular books in a fraction of the time it would take to read the full text. The app leverages structured content delivery, user-friendly features, and a systematic approach to ensure that readers gain key insights efficiently. Below is a detailed breakdown of how the app functions, covering its core mechanisms, features, and user experience.
1. Content Curation and Summary Creation
Selection of Books
The app’s team begins by identifying high-impact books across genres such as business, self-help, psychology, and productivity. The selection criteria include:

Popularity and Influence: Books that have consistently ranked on bestseller lists or are widely recommended.
Practical Value: Titles that offer actionable insights rather than purely theoretical concepts.
Diverse Perspectives: A balanced mix of classic and contemporary works to cater to different reader preferences.
Summarization Process
Once a book is selected, professional summarizers or subject-matter experts condense the material while preserving its essence. The summarization follows a structured approach:
Key Themes Extraction: Identifying the book’s central arguments, theories, and frameworks.
Chapter-by-Chapter Breakdown: Distilling each chapter into its most critical points.
Actionable Takeaways: Highlighting practical advice or steps that readers can apply in real life.
Elimination of Redundancy: Removing repetitive content while maintaining coherence.
The summaries are typically structured to be read in 15 minutes or less, ensuring accessibility for busy individuals.
2. App Interface and Navigation
User Onboarding
Upon downloading the app, users are guided through a brief onboarding process where they can:
Set Preferences: Select preferred genres or topics to receive personalized recommendations.
Choose a Reading Plan: Opt for daily, weekly, or ad-hoc summaries based on their schedule.
Explore Free vs. Premium Content: Some summaries may be free, while others require a subscription.
Home Screen and Discovery
The home screen serves as the central hub, featuring:
Featured Summaries: Curated selections based on trending or highly rated books.
Categories: Organized sections like "Business," "Psychology," or "Biographies" for easy browsing.
Search Functionality: Allows users to find specific books or authors quickly.
Reading Experience
When a user selects a summary, they are presented with:
Overview: A brief introduction to the book’s premise and author.
Key Takeaways: Bullet points or short paragraphs summarizing core ideas.
Chapter Summaries: Condensed versions of each chapter, often with subheadings for clarity.
Quotes and Highlights: Notable passages from the original book.
Audio Option: Some summaries include an audio version for hands-free listening.
3. Learning Tools and Features
Bookmarking and Note-Taking
Users can:
Save Summaries: Bookmark summaries for later reference.
Highlight Text: Select important sections for future review.
Add Personal Notes: Annotate summaries with their thoughts or applications.
Progress Tracking
The app may include:
Reading History: A log of completed summaries.
Time Spent: Metrics on how much time a user has spent reading or listening.
Achievements: Badges or milestones for consistent usage.
Offline Access
Summaries can often be downloaded for offline reading, making the app useful during commutes or travel.
4. Personalization and Recommendations
Algorithmic Suggestions
Based on user behavior (e.g., completed summaries, saved titles), the app recommends:
Similar Books: Summaries from the same genre or author.
Trending Content: Popular summaries among other users.
Tailored Learning Paths: Sequential recommendations for users interested in a specific topic (e.g., leadership or mindfulness).
User Feedback Integration
Users can rate summaries or provide feedback, which helps refine future recommendations and content quality.
